Disclaimer: Programming radios requires knowledge of radio regulations. Always use frequencies you are licensed to operate on.
Ensure your channel spacing complies with local regulations. Most modern systems use Narrowband ( 12.5 kHz ), though legacy systems might still use Wideband ( 25 kHz ).

: Newer "factory" versions of CPS may only support 12.5 kHz narrowband frequency spacing to comply with FCC regulations, which can be a limitation for some legacy or amateur uses.
The Motorola CM140 is a workhorse radio, but programming it requires legacy software (RVN4185 CPS), a serial cable (RKN4106A), and patience with Windows compatibility. When in doubt, trust a Motorola dealer to handle the job safely.
